BUG/MINOR: log: t_idle (%Ti) is not set for some requests
|
|
|
|
If TCP content inspection is used, msg_state can be >= HTTP_MSG_ERROR
|
|
the first time http_wait_for_request is called. t_idle was being left
|
|
unset in that case.
|
|
|
|
In the example below :
|
|
stick-table type string len 64 size 100k expire 60s
|
|
tcp-request inspect-delay 1s
|
|
tcp-request content track-sc1 hdr(X-Session)
|
|
|
|
%Ti will always be -1, because the msg_state is already at HTTP_MSG_BODY
|
|
when http_wait_for_request is called for the first time.
|
|
|
|
This patch should backported to 1.8 and 1.7.
